Stocking Stuffers!

Stuff those stockings with a little Staci Gray! There’s still time to pick up The Crocodile Dance, Austin based children’s performer, Staci Gray’s recently released CD. And it is getting rave reviews from local preschoolers! It has already become Baby Scoop Austin’s four-year-old CEO (Chief Entertainment Officer), Olivia O’Bannon’s, favorite CD. Kids will giggle, clap, and dance a jig to songs like “Silly Things”, where Staci and her tot-sized back-up “noise makers” have a blast making silly noises mixed with a catchy-sing-a-long song. Even more silly is “What’s that Smell”, a funky retro rock tune describing smells of all sorts from roses to chocolate chip cookies to stinky diapers and trash cans. Staci’s exuberant personality and love of children shines through each song, with each being surprisingly different from the next, she keeps you wanting more. The songs of the The Crocodile Dance tell stories and teach lessons like, “I love Being Green” where Staci and the kids remind young listeners to “turn off the water when brushing your teeth” and “click the light” off when you leave the room. Just wait until you hear what Mingo can do! Who’s Mingo? Just listen to the cd and you will love him too! Also, this is a great new cd to pick up if you are planning a road trip for Christmas. Great instrumentals, sound effects and vocals make this cd fun for the whole family. Parents, you will even find yourself belting out the lyrics and tapping your finger on the steering wheel to these catchy tunes even after you drop the kids off at preschool. (Believe me, it happend to me today!) The cd can be purchased at any one of Staci's live shows, Book People, Austin Baby, and Austin Children's Museum.
